Introduction
From the Project Euler Website:
Project Euler is a series of challenging mathematical/computer programming problems that will require more than just mathematical insights to solve. Although mathematics will help you arrive at elegant and efficient methods, the use of a computer and programming skills will be required to solve most problems.
The motivation for starting Project Euler, and its continuation, is to provide a platform for the inquiring mind to delve into unfamiliar areas and learn new concepts in a fun and recreational context.
Solutions (C++)
- 001 Solution
- 002 Solution
- 003 Solution
- 004 Solution
- 005 Solution
- 006 Solution
- 007 Solution
- 008 Solution
- 009 Solution
- 010 Solution
- 011 Solution
- 012 Solution
- 013 Solution
- 014 Solution
- 015 Solution
- 016 Solution
- 017 Solution
- 018 Solution
- 019 Solution
- 020 Solution
- 021 Solution
- 022 Solution
- 023 Solution
Support (C++)
Solutions (ruby)
- 001 Solution
- 002 Solution
- 003 Solution
- 004 Solution
- 005 Solution
- 006 Solution
- 007 Solution
- 008 Solution
- 009 Solution
- 010 Solution
- 011 Solution
- 012 Solution
- 013 Solution
- 014 Solution
- 015 Solution
- 016 Solution
- 017 Solution
- 018 Solution
- 019 Solution